write an equation of a line in point-slope form that passes through (-4,-7) and has a slope of -2

Answer :

[tex]\bf (\stackrel{x_1}{-4}~,~\stackrel{y_1}{-7}) \qquad \qquad \qquad % slope = m slope = m\implies -2 \\\\\\ % point-slope intercept \stackrel{\textit{point-slope form}}{y- y_1= m(x- x_1)}\implies y-(-7)=-2[x-(-4)] \\\\\\ y+7=-2(x+4)[/tex]
